Chapter 123 Lucian's POV The air in the Veil was so heavy and sad that it felt like it was covering me with another layer of skin. The shadows moved around me, acting as if they wanted to grab me and pull me in. I couldn't make out where the Veil ended. I was never able to. It was only endless darkness. I was wondering if the place was so dark or if what I was about to do was. Even so, I could feel it—the pull. The sound of his voice was so familiar that it seemed I had known it all my life. The intense pain in my chest made me keep going. I couldn't help but do it. Every step I made seemed to get heavier and heavier. My body reacted without thinking, as if the Veil understood me and had always known the way to lead me. And from a distance, I could see him. The Ash-Born. My brother.
